Catalysis in drug development

Catalysis plays a pivotal role in drug development by expediting reactions, enhancing yields, and minimizing unwanted byproducts. In chemical engineering, catalysis involves designing and optimizing catalysts to facilitate key synthetic steps in drug synthesis. Cutting-edge technologies, such as high-throughput screening and computational modeling, enable the rapid discovery and optimization of catalysts for specific reactions. This accelerates the development of new drugs and improves the efficiency of existing processes. Catalysis also enables greener and more sustainable practices by reducing the use of harsh reagents and energy-intensive processes. Overall, the integration of catalysis, chemical engineering, and technology revolutionizes drug development, making it more efficient, cost-effective, and environmentally friendly.
